A wide sloping deposit of sediment formed where a stream leaves a mountain range is called an alluvial fan. An alluvial fan is the deposition of sediment on a landform like mountain. It forms as an open fan or cone of sediment. The sediments are left by natural drainage system like river on the landform.
There are two types of alluvial fans.
1. Debris dominated: These includes viscous mixture of water, mud, gravel along with woody debris. This transfer large boulders of landform soil.
2. Floodwater dominated: Water will spill in the alluvial fan in the form of thin sheets. This can transfer fine particles of landform soil.

A dominant organism can be heterozygous or homozygous for the gene. To determine the genotype of a dominant organism, it is crossed with a homozygous recessive organism for the same gene. In the given cross, a tall pea plant with an unknown genotype is crossed with a pure breeding short pea plant. This is called a testcross.
If the obtained progeny express both tall and short phenotypes, the tall parent plant was heterozygous (Tt) for the trait. If the cross gives only tall progeny, the genotype of the tall plant is homozygous dominant (TT). Here, T represents the allele for tallness while the allele "t" gives short phenotype.
